Veterinarian – Vetco Total Care Full Service Veterinary Hospital

The Veterinarian will provide high‑quality medical care to clients and their pets within the Vetco Total Care full‑service hospital, performing examinations, diagnostics, surgeries, and dental procedures while maintaining meticulous medical records and ensuring excellent client communication.

Essential Job Functions
  • Provide excellent patient care by performing physical examinations, diagnosing and treating diseases, and providing preventive care according to patient signalment, lifestyle, and environment.
  • Utilize a problem‑based approach that includes developing a complete problem list for every patient examined, a complete list of differential diagnoses for each problem identified, a complete diagnostic plan, and appropriate treatments based on interpretation of diagnostic test results.
  • Document all patient observations, findings of exams and diagnostics, treatments and medications, client interactions, and tentative and confirmed diagnoses in the medical record in a concise and detailed fashion, according to practice convention.
  • Perform routine and complex surgical procedures, including spays/neuters, abdominal exploratory, and mass removals.
  • Perform routine and complex dental procedures, including full dental examination, evaluation of dental radiographs, and simple and complex extractions and oral surgical procedures.
  • Develop treatment plans for patients undergoing day hospitalization based on complete problem‑based assessment. Transition patients to overnight care as needed and communicate effectively with referral hospitals to ensure continuity of patient care.
Other Duties and Responsibilities
  • Participate in rounds as incoming or exiting doctor at the beginning and end of shifts.
  • Disseminate knowledge throughout staff to improve the level of care and communication provided to hospital partners, to both the patient and the client.
  • Perform additional duties as assigned.
Nature of Supervision

In all activities related to the care of individual patients, the Veterinarian will take direct supervision from the Hospital Medical Leader or Area Medical Director. The Veterinarian will have discretion regarding patient‑care decisions while upholding the standards set forth in Petco Veterinary SOPs and accepting guidance from the medical leader through electronic record review.

Education/Experience
  • Doctor of Veterinary Medicine degree or equivalent from an AVMA‑accredited veterinary school.
  • Active licensure as a veterinarian without contingencies in the state where the hospital is located or ability to obtain by the start date.
  • Current DEA license.
  • Current Controlled Substance License, if applicable, in the state where the hospital is located or ability to obtain by the start date.
  • USDA Category I accreditation (minimum) or completion within two months of hire date.
  • Comfortable performing anesthesia and routine surgeries, including dog and cat spays, neuters, mass removals, and dental surgeries.
  • Excellent written and verbal communication skills.
  • Compassionate, sympathetic, and able to maintain a professional demeanor during emotional and stressful situations.
  • Telephone and computer skills.
  • Team player willing to learn new techniques and treatments, offer creative ideas, and accept change.
Work Environment

The majority of duties are carried out in the Vetco Total Care veterinary full‑service hospital. The position requires bending, kneeling, lifting (up to 30 pounds as necessary), and standing for long periods of time. Significant time is spent in direct contact with clients and their pets.
